Legacy modernization
Transforming existing systems to align with evolving technologies

What is legacy modernization?
Legacy modernization upgrades outdated software and systems to use modern technologies, architectures, and capabilities. This process revitalizes older systems, aligning them with current industry standards to maintain competitiveness and adaptability.
Rather than simply replacing old technology, a true legacy transformation effort does not stop at modernization. For large organizations to truly remain competitive in a rapidly shifting technological landscape, they need innovative solutions that enhance system performance and business operations as part of a larger legacy transformation program.
Why is legacy modernization important?
As technology advances, businesses with outdated systems face challenges in efficiency and competitiveness. Modern systems enhance agility, reduce overhead costs, and improve customer experiences, supporting growth and relevance. Many teams start with modernizing legacy applications, but oftentimes, a more complete legacy transformation effort is needed to optimize workflows and enable true AI-powered business orchestration.
Benefits of legacy modernization
- Business agility: Allows organizations to respond more quickly to market changes and customer needs
- Cost reduction: Reduces maintenance costs associated with supporting outdated systems
- Enhanced user experience: Delivers intuitive interfaces that boost user satisfaction and engagement and creates seamless integrations between systems
- Risk management: Addresses security vulnerabilities inherent in older systems and ensures compliance with current regulations and standards

How does legacy modernization work?
Legacy modernization begins with assessing current systems to plan upgrades, followed by prioritizing scalable, interoperable solutions for seamless connectivity. Organizations then select the best modernization strategies, like replatforming or replacing systems. Effective implementation and change management are also crucial to minimize disruptions and ensure user adoption.

Supercharge your enterprise with Pega Blueprint
What’s the difference between legacy modernization and legacy transformation?
Recognizing the need for modernization
A business should consider legacy modernization if it experiences:
High maintenance costs
As systems age, maintenance becomes more expensive due to the scarcity of skilled personnel and obsolete hardware.
Slow performance
Slow response times, lagging applications, and sluggish data processing hinder productivity and frustrate users.
Security vulnerabilities
Legacy systems often lack the latest security patches and protocols, making them vulnerable to cyberattacks.
Acknowledging the need for legacy modernization is merely the starting point; enterprises must also engage in comprehensive legacy transformation to thrive in today's dynamic AI-driven landscape.

Best practices for updating legacy systems
- Prioritize based on business impact: Focus first on modernizing components that deliver the highest business value.
- Adopt a phased approach: Break down the modernization into manageable phases rather than attempting a complete transformation.
- Implement robust testing strategies: Develop comprehensive testing plans that cover all aspects of functionality.
- Plan for risk mitigation: Identify potential risks such as downtime, data loss, or budget overruns.
Beyond legacy: Embracing the digital future
Legacy modernization is evolving rapidly, driven by AI and changing business needs. AI will automate code analysis, refactoring, data migration, and testing while enhancing security and compliance. It will also optimize resource allocation and workflows, cutting costs. With AI’s speed in processing data, organizations can gain insights faster, improve decision-making, and modernize legacy applications quickly and effectively.

Frequently asked questions for legacy modernization
Some challenges with legacy modernization include:
- Complexity of existing systems: Many legacy applications are built on outdated technologies that are difficult to integrate with modern solutions.
- Data migration issues: Transferring large volumes of critical data without disruption presents technical challenges.
- Evolving requirements: Organizations must remain adaptable to changing market demands throughout the modernization process.
It's important to take a strategic approach to modernization alongside vendors and technology partners that can mitigate these challenges and ensure a rapid, successful transition.
Choosing the right modernization approach for each legacy system is a critical decision that requires careful evaluation. There's no one-size-fits-all solution, and the best approach will depend on a variety of factors, including business needs, technical requirements, budget, and available resources.
Maintaining modernized systems is just as crucial as the modernization process itself. Organizations can ensure longevity with:
- Regular maintenance: Ensures that your investment continues to deliver value and remains aligned with evolving business needs.
- Proactive monitoring and updates: Safeguard against potential vulnerabilities.
- Regular system audits and performance assessments: Provide valuable insights that empower IT professionals to make informed decisions about necessary upgrades and integrations.